Altium PCB Design Complete Course In Hindi/Urdu

In This is a tutorial or training video that provides step-by-step guidance on how to use Altium software for printed circuit board (PCB) design. The video is designed for electronics engineers, hobbyists, and students who are new to PCB design and want to learn how to use Altium to create high-quality, professional PCBs. The video covers topics such as schematic capture, component placement, routing, and gerber generation. With this video, you will gain a comprehensive understanding of how to use Altium to design and manufacture your own PCBs with confidence. Introduction: Brief overview of what Altium Designer is and its purpose Discuss the features and capabilities of Altium Designer Explain why it is widely used in the electronics industry Getting Started: Discuss the system requirements and installation process Give a tour of the Altium Designer interface, including the main menu, toolbars, and panels Discuss the different file types and projects used in Altium Designer.
